A teleprompter is a device that displays scripted text in front of a camera lens, using a beam-splitter glass that reflects the text to the presenter while remaining transparent to the camera behind it, allowing the presenter to read the script while appearing to maintain direct eye contact with the viewer. This is standard equipment in television news broadcast, but its use has expanded significantly into corporate video production, training content creation, livestreamed events and any setting where a presenter needs to deliver precise, scripted content without the unnatural look of reading off a separate screen or paper. Teleprompters range from studio-mounted broadcast units with large, high-brightness displays to compact, camera-mounted units for field and interview use, down to tablet-based presenter units for smaller productions.

How to Choose the Right Teleprompter Solution

Broadcast Studio vs Portable/Field Teleprompters

Broadcast studio teleprompters use larger, high-brightness displays and robust mounting hardware built for a fixed studio camera setup running continuously through a production day. Portable and field teleprompters are compact, camera-mounted units designed to be set up and broken down quickly for location shoots, interviews and events. Buyers producing regular studio content need the former, while video production companies and corporate teams doing varied location shoots need the portability of the latter.

Beam-Splitter Glass Quality

The beam-splitter glass is the core optical component that determines how clearly the presenter can read the text and how invisible the reflection is to the camera. Lower-quality glass introduces visible ghosting or reduces image clarity through to the camera, which matters more than it might seem for professional-looking output. This is a component worth checking quality on rather than assuming all teleprompters perform equally regardless of price point.

Display Size and Text Readability

Display size affects how far back the presenter can comfortably stand from the camera while still reading text clearly, which matters for framing shots correctly, particularly in corporate video where the presenter often needs to be a specific distance from camera for the desired shot composition. Matching display size to the typical shooting distance for the production's usual setup avoids a mismatch discovered only during a shoot.

Camera and Rig Compatibility

Teleprompters need to mount compatibly with the camera and rig being used, whether that's a broadcast studio camera, a DSLR/mirrorless setup for corporate video, or a tablet-camera combination for simpler productions. Checking mounting compatibility with the actual camera equipment in use, rather than assuming universal compatibility, avoids an awkward rig mismatch on shoot day.

Software and Script Control

Teleprompter software controls scroll speed, text formatting and remote control of the scrolling during a live read, and the quality of this software affects how smoothly a presenter can deliver content, particularly for live or livestreamed presentations where scroll speed needs to track the presenter's natural pace. Testing the software's remote control and scroll-smoothness before a critical live production is worth doing rather than discovering issues during an actual broadcast.

Portability for Multi-Location Productions

For production companies and corporate teams that shoot at varied locations rather than a fixed studio, teleprompter setup and breakdown time, weight and case portability become practically important considerations alongside the core display and optical quality, since a technically excellent but cumbersome unit slows down every location shoot.
